Description

This is an official California Judicial Council approved form, a Caused Another Child's Death Through Abuse or Neglect document for use in California courts. Complete the form by filling in the blanks as appropriate. USLF control no. CA-JV-125.

Types of Abuse or Neglect: a) Physical Abuse: In some cases, child fatalities occur as a result of physical abuse, where a child may suffer severe injuries or assaults inflicted by an individual responsible for their care. b) Neglect: Neglect refers to the failure to provide a child with essential care and protection, including necessities like food, shelter, and medical attention. In cases of severe neglect, a child's neglectful environment can lead to their tragic death. 3. Investigating the Circumstances: Immediately following the incident, local authorities, law enforcement, and child welfare agencies initiate thorough investigations to determine the causes and circumstances leading to the child's unfortunate demise. a) Collaborative efforts: A team of professionals, including social workers, medical experts, and law enforcement personnel, collaborate closely to gather evidence, interview the individuals involved, and ensure that justice is served. b) Autopsy and forensic analysis: An autopsy and forensic analysis are conducted to determine the cause of death, identify any pre-existing conditions, or gather evidence that may help incriminate those responsible for abuse or neglect. 4.
